Southern England

2. Southern England

Rick looks at red cider from Somerset, peppery watercress from Hampshire streams, and Thomas Hardy's favourite cheese.
London, Midlands, East England

3. London, Midlands, East England

Rick investigates London's Borough market, samples eel pie, visits a free-range goose farm in Leicester, and has a pint or two at a brewery in Scotland.
North West England

4. North West England

Rick tries a traditional hot pot and cheese in Lancashire, and he finds wild boar in the Lake District.

South East England

5. South East England

In Bognor Regis, Rick samples whelks and prepares steak and kidney pudding, before exploring the herbal delights of a walled garden in Sussex and supporting a campaign to save the sea bass.

Midlands and East England

6. Midlands and East England

In East Anglia and the Midlands, Rick tries an array of scrumptious local dishes, including Norfolk Black turkeys, Lincolnshire chine and speciality pork pies. Plus, the champion of British cheeses, Stilton.
North East England

7. North East England

In Wakefield, Rick meets Janet Oldroyd, whose family have been harvesting rhubarb for the past four generations, and they whip up a tasty rhubarb crumble. Then in Bradford, he discovers the perfect recipe for lamb karahi at a Karachi restaurant.
South East England & Wales

8. South East England & Wales

Rick and his little hairy friend, Chalky, pay a visit to Rick's favourite formal vegetable garden at Chatsworth House. He crosses the River Severn to sample the delights of Wales, including cawl and Welsh black cattle.
North East England & Scotland

9. North East England & Scotland

Rick travels north and cooks salmon caught on a trip on the River Tyne. He then crosses over into Scotland to visit Loch Fyne, before sampling Highland beef from an organic farm on the Isle of Mull and meeting a champion haggis maker in Edinburgh.
North Scotland

10. North Scotland

En route to completing his journey at John O'Groats, Rick enjoys freshly cooked lobster on Crail harbour front and obtains oatmeal from a watermill in the Tay Valley to make the famous Scottish dessert Cranachan.
